Content Marketing vs Social Media Marketing
Meaning
Content Marketing: In this, useful and valuable content is created and distributed through blogs, videos, ebooks, podcasts, etc. to attract the target audience. Social Media Marketing: In this, brand awareness is increased by sharing content on social media platforms like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, LinkedIn, etc. It is directly connected to the customers. The only difference between Content Marketing and Social Media Marketing is that in Content Marketing, we create useful and valuable content through any video, ebook, podcast, whereas through Social Media Marketing, we are connected to the customers through apps.
Goals
The purpose of content marketing is to increase the brand’s credibility, generate leads and increase website traffic, while the purpose of social media marketing is to popularize the brand, communicate with customers and increase social engagement. Both of these work for business and are complementary to both.
Platforms & Channels
Content marketing works on platforms like website, blog, YouTube, email, etc. They podcast their content, whereas social media marketing works on platforms like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, TikTok, etc. by putting links.
